黑狐家游戏

关系型数据库术语包括哪些,关系型数据库术语包括

欧气 3 0

标题:探索关系型数据库术语的奥秘

一、引言

在当今数字化时代,关系型数据库是存储和管理大量结构化数据的核心工具,了解关系型数据库术语对于有效地设计、开发和维护数据库系统至关重要,本文将深入探讨关系型数据库中常见的术语,帮助读者更好地理解和运用这一强大的数据管理技术。

二、关系型数据库术语概述

(一)表(Table)

表是关系型数据库中最基本的结构单元,用于存储数据,它由行和列组成,每行代表一个记录,每列代表一个属性。

(二)字段(Field)

字段是表中的列,用于定义数据的类型和属性,在一个学生表中,可能有“学号”、“姓名”、“年龄”等字段。

(三)记录(Record)

记录是表中的行,代表一个具体的实体或对象,在学生表中,每一行代表一个学生的信息。

(四)主键(Primary Key)

主键是表中的一个字段或一组字段,用于唯一标识表中的每一条记录,主键的值不能重复,且不能为空。

(五)外键(Foreign Key)

外键是表中的一个字段,用于建立与其他表的关联,外键的值必须是关联表中主键的值,或者为空。

(六)关系(Relationship)

关系是表之间的关联,通过外键实现,常见的关系类型包括一对一、一对多和多对多。

(七)数据库(Database)

数据库是一组相关的数据表的集合,用于存储和管理数据,数据库可以包含多个表,并且这些表之间通过关系相互关联。

(八)SQL(Structured Query Language)

SQL 是用于访问和操作关系型数据库的标准语言,它包括数据定义语言(DDL)、数据操作语言(DML)和数据查询语言(DQL)等部分。

三、关系型数据库术语的详细解释

(一)表的创建和设计

在创建表时,需要定义表的名称、字段的名称和数据类型,以及是否为主键等属性,合理的表设计可以提高数据库的性能和可维护性。

(二)数据的插入、更新和删除

可以使用 SQL 语句将数据插入到表中,更新表中的数据,或者删除表中的记录,在进行这些操作时,需要注意数据的完整性和一致性。

(三)数据的查询和检索

SQL 提供了强大的数据查询语言,可以根据不同的条件从表中检索数据,常见的查询操作包括选择、投影、连接和聚合等。

(四)索引的使用

索引是提高数据库查询性能的重要手段,通过在表的字段上创建索引,可以加快数据的检索速度,过多的索引也会影响数据库的插入、更新和删除性能。

(五)视图的创建和使用

视图是基于表的虚拟表,它可以根据特定的条件从表中检索数据,并将结果以一种特定的方式呈现给用户,视图可以提高数据的安全性和灵活性。

(六)存储过程的创建和使用

存储过程是一组预编译的 SQL 语句,可以在数据库中执行特定的任务,存储过程可以提高数据库的性能和可维护性,并且可以减少网络流量和客户端的负担。

(七)数据库的备份和恢复

为了防止数据丢失,需要定期对数据库进行备份,备份可以将数据库的状态保存到一个或多个文件中,以便在需要时进行恢复。

四、结论

关系型数据库术语是理解和运用关系型数据库的基础,通过掌握这些术语,我们可以更好地设计、开发和维护数据库系统,提高数据的存储和管理效率,在实际应用中,我们还需要根据具体的需求和场景,灵活运用这些术语和技术,以实现最佳的数据库性能和效果。

标签: #关系型数据库 #术语 #包括 #哪些

黑狐家游戏
  • 评论列表

留言评论